13.47 Write Sectors (30h/31h)
Table 129: Write Sectors Command (30h/31h)
The Write Sectors command transfers one or more sectors from the host to the device. The data is then written to
the disk media.
The sectors are transferred through the Data Register 16 bits at a time.
If an uncorrectable error occurs, the write will be terminated at the failing sector, when the auto reassign function is
disable.
Output parameters to the device
Sector Count This indicates the number of continuous sectors to be transferred. If the Sector Count of
zero is specified, 256 sectors will be transferred.
LBA Low This indicates the sector number of the first sector to be transferred. (L = 0)
In LBA mode this register contains the LBA bits 0–7. (L = 1)
LBA High/Mid This indicates the cylinder number of the first sector to be transferred. (L = 0)
In LBA mode this register contains the LBA bits 8–15 (Mid) and bits 16–23 (High)
(L = 1)
H This indicates the head number of the first sector to be transferred. (L = 0)
In LBA mode this register contains the LBA bits 24–27. (L = 1)
R This indicates the retry bit; this bit is ignored.
Input parameters from the device
Sector Count This indicates the number of requested sectors not transferred. The Sector Count will be
zero unless an unrecoverable error occurs.
LBA Low This indicates the sector number of the last transferred sector. (L = 0)
In LBA mode this register contains the current LBA bits 0–7. (L = 1)
